How Ceponax 100mg Tablet works:
Ceponax 100mg tablets are antibacterial, eliminating bacteria by disrupting their essential cell wall formation, thereby hindering their survival.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holSAFE
There are no known adverse reactions from concurrent use of Ceponax 100mg Tablet and alcohol.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Ceponax 100mg tablets during pregnancy is typically regarded as safe. Preclinical trials in animals have indicated minimal or no harmful consequences for the fetus; nonetheless, data from human studies are sc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The medication Ceponax 100mg Tablet is considered safe for breastfeeding mothers. Research in humans indicates minimal transfer of the drug into breast milk, posing no known risk to infants. However, extended use of Ceponax 100mg Tablet should be avoided due to potential side effects including skin rashes and diarrhea.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a Ceponax 100mg tablet might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, reducing your alertness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with severe renal impairment should exercise caution when using Ceponax 100m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Patients with liver disease can safely use Ceponax 100mg tablets without requiring a dosage modification.
What if you forget to take Ceponax 100m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Ceponax 100mg Tablet dose, take it immediately. However, near the time for your next scheduled dose, omit the missed one and resume your usual dosing regimen. Never take a double dose.
